The most common questions about the 3.5% redirection through Quorify 230:
Does redirecting 3.5% cost me anything?+
No. You're redirecting part of the tax the state already withholds. In other words, you don't pay anything extra.
Do I need an account to fill in the form?+
No. You fill in Form 230 directly from the organization's public page, with no account, in about two minutes.
Who files the form with ANAF?+
The receiving organization handles filing with ANAF on your behalf. Once you submit the form, there's nothing more for you to do.
Does Quorify file the form or handle money?+
No. Quorify only generates Form 230 and sends it to the chosen organization. The platform doesn't file with ANAF and doesn't handle money.
What does the “Share for 2 years” option mean?+
If you check it, the redirection also applies to the following fiscal year, to the same organization, without needing to fill in the form again.
Is my data (CNP) safe?+
Yes. The CNP and other data are encrypted and used only to generate the form and share it with the organization, based on your consent, in compliance with GDPR.
